METHOD AND DEVICE FOR CHECKING AN ADHESIVE CONNECTION BETWEEN A HOLLOW NEEDLE OR CANNULA AND A HOLDING PART
20220249782 · 2022-08-11 ·

A method is described for checking an adhesive connection between a hollow needle or cannula of a medical syringe and a holding part, wherein the hollow needle or cannula is inserted with play in a holding portion of the holding part, and an intermediate space between the hollow needle or cannula and the holding portion is at least partially filled with an adhesive body. The adhesive body is detected by means of an optical detection device in the form of a camera, and the detection device transmits image data relating to the adhesive body to an evaluation unit in which the data are evaluated. The ACTUAL volume and/or the ACTUAL configuration of the adhesive body is determined from the image data of the adhesive body and compared with a TARGET volume and/or a TARGET configuration of the adhesive body.

PEN NEEDLE ASSEMBLY

A needle hub assembly for a pen needle includes a needle hub, an inner shield and an outer cover. The open end of the outer cover is closed by a removable seal to access the needle hub. The needle hub has a body with a shoulder and a tower extending from the body for supporting a cannula. The inner shield fits over the tower and the cannula and includes a flange that has an outer dimension complementing the outer dimension of the needle hub and contacts the shoulder of the needle hub in the assembled condition. The outer cover encloses the needle hub and the inner shield and includes a stop member on an inner surface that contacts the flange of the inner shield to capture the inner shield between the shoulder of the needle hub and the outer cover.

Adaptor for a drug delivery device and drug delivery device
11833339 · 2023-12-05 · ·

The present invention relates to adaptor (30) for a drug delivery device having a reservoir (12) and a longitudinal tip (20), the adaptor (30) comprising a distal part defining a connecting ring (31) intended to receive a connector, and a proximal part defining a mounting ring (33) having an inner surface (34), the mounting ring (33) being shaped and configured such that, when the adaptor (30) is mounted around the longitudinal tip (20) of the drug delivery device, at least one annular space (38) is created between said inner surface (34) of the mounting ring (33) and said outer surface (20a) of the longitudinal tip (20), said at least one annular space (38) being able to accommodate an adhesive layer (40) in order to bond said adaptor (30) to said longitudinal tip. The invention further relates to a drug delivery device comprising such an adaptor.

Method for connecting two objects using a polymer composition and a system, for use in a cosmetic procedure

The invention is directed to a method for using a polymer composition for connecting a first object to a second object, wherein the method comprises, the step of applying a polymer composition to at least part of the surface of at least one of the first object or second object; connecting the first object and the second object at the surface where the polymer composition is applied and irradiating the polymer composition using UV-radiation over a first time period, obtaining a UV radiated polymer composition; irradiating the UV radiated polymer composition with gamma-radiation over a second time period obtaining a gamma radiated polymer. The invention also relates to a system of a plastic object and a metal object connected by the method of the invention. In addition, the invention relates to a cosmetic method for anti-aging skin treatment wherein the method comprises the steps of: subcutaneously administering of an effective amount a of a dermal filler or Botulinum toxin to an area of skin, preferably the face and/or neck area, wherein the administering is performed by a syringe and a hypodermic needle or cannula of the invention.

PEN NEEDLE HUB HAVING INCREASED CONTACT AREA
20210138164 · 2021-05-13 ·

A pen needle assembly having a hub with an increased surface area that contacts a patient's skin is provided. The increased contact area of the hub with the patient's skin during injection of a cannula decreases the pressure exerted against the patient's skin, thereby increasing the comfort of the patient. A bonding adhesive is disposed on an outer surface of the hub, thereby decreasing the required curing time of the adhesive. Additionally, the increased contact area, between the cannula adhesive and hub increases the strength of the bond therebetween.

Method for producing a syringe having a piercing means

The invention relates to a method for producing a syringe having a piercing means, comprising the following steps: a) providing a syringe body having a distal end section, which comprises an inner channel that discharges at a distal opening, wherein the distal end section is in a formable state; b) providing a piercing means; c) inserting a proximal section of the piercing means through the distal opening into the inner channel of the distal end section; and d) shaping the distal end section by means of a first shaping tool in such a way that an inner surface of the distal end section contacts at least portions of the piercing means, as a result of which at least portions of the piercing means are secured.
